本文作者:admin

magento服务器

admin 2024-04-30 0 0条评论

一、magento服务器

Magento服务器和网站性能优化

Magento服务器和网站性能优化

作为一个经营在线商店的Magento网站所有者,您了解网站性能对用户体验和销售业绩的重要性。因此,为您的Magento网站选择适当的服务器以及对其进行性能优化是非常重要的。

1. 选择合适的Magento服务器

在选择Magento服务器之前,您需要考虑以下几个关键因素:

  • 可靠性:选择一个可靠的服务提供商,确保您的网站始终在线。
  • 性能:确保服务器的硬件配置和网络连接能够满足您网站的访问量和需求。
  • 安全性:选择提供安全防护措施的服务器,以保护您和您的客户的数据。
  • 可扩展性:确保服务器能够轻松扩展,以应对未来网站流量的增长。

2. Magento服务器的硬件要求

Magento是一个功能强大且复杂的电子商务平台,因此它对服务器硬件的要求比较高。以下是一些推荐的硬件要求:

  • 处理器:至少需要双核心处理器。
  • 内存:建议至少有4GB的内存。
  • 磁盘空间:至少需要50GB的可用磁盘空间。
  • 网络连接:选择具备高带宽和低延迟的网络连接。

3. Magento服务器的性能优化

为了提高Magento网站的性能,以下是一些服务器性能优化的建议:

  • 使用缓存:启用Magento的缓存功能,以减少页面加载时间。
  • 使用CDN:使用内容分发网络(CDN)可以加速网站的静态资源加载速度。
  • 压缩资源:使用Gzip等技术对静态资源进行压缩,以减少传输时间。
  • 优化数据库:定期清理和优化数据库,以提高查询性能。
  • 启用缓存代理:使用缓存代理服务器,如Varnish,可以显著提高网站的响应速度。
  • 优化图片:使用适当的图片格式和压缩工具对图片进行优化,以减少其文件大小。
  • 使用最新的Magento版本:确保您的Magento安装是最新版本,以获得最好的性能和安全性。

4. 定期监测和优化

优化Magento服务器是一个持续的过程,您应该定期进行监测和优化。使用监测工具来分析网站性能,并根据分析结果进行相应的优化。

一些常用的监测工具包括:

  • New Relic:用于监测网站的性能和代码。
  • GTmetrix:用于测试网站的速度和性能。
  • Google Analytics:用于监测网站的访问量和用户行为。
  • Pingdom:用于监测网站的可用性和响应时间。

定期监测和优化Magento服务器可以确保您的网站始终保持良好的性能,并提供优秀的用户体验。

5. 结论

Magento服务器的选择和性能优化对于一个在线商店的成功非常重要。通过选择合适的服务器,并遵循一些性能优化的最佳实践,您可以确保您的Magento网站始终以最佳状态运行。

希望本文提供的Magento服务器和网站性能优化建议对您有所帮助。祝您的Magento网站取得巨大的成功!

二、magento服务器要求

随着电子商务的蓬勃发展,越来越多的企业选择搭建自己的在线商城。在选择合适的电商平台时,Magento成为了众多企业的首选。作为一个强大而灵活的电商平台,Magento提供了许多功能和特性,使得企业能够轻松地搭建和管理自己的在线商店。

Magento的服务器要求

然而,要顺利安装和运行Magento,服务器的性能和配置也是至关重要的。合理的服务器设置不仅能提供流畅的用户体验,还能确保网站的安全和稳定。

下面是一些关于Magento服务器要求的重要指南,以帮助您进行正确的配置和优化。

操作系统

Magento可以运行在多种操作系统上,包括Windows、Linux和Unix。但是,在选择操作系统时,我们建议您使用Linux作为服务器的操作系统。Linux操作系统在安全性、稳定性和性能方面都表现出色,能够更好地支持Magento的功能和特性。

Web服务器

对于Web服务器,Magento支持多种选择,包括Apache、Nginx和LiteSpeed等。Apache是最常用的Web服务器之一,使用广泛且稳定可靠。Nginx则以其高性能和占用资源少的特点而受到欢迎。LiteSpeed是一款高性能的商业Web服务器,能够实现更快的响应速度。

无论选择哪种Web服务器,都需要确保服务器具备足够的性能和资源,以应对高流量和高并发的访问请求。

数据库服务器

Magento使用MySQL作为默认的数据库服务器。当配置数据库服务器时,确保使用最新版本的MySQL,并进行正确的优化和调整。

为了提高性能,您可以考虑使用MySQL的缓存功能,如使用内存缓存和查询缓存。此外,定期进行数据库优化和索引优化也是重要的步骤。

PHP

Magento是基于PHP开发的,因此服务器必须安装并配置适当的PHP版本。Magento要求PHP版本在5.6.x以上,并建议使用最新的PHP版本以获得更好的性能和安全性。

您还需要确保服务器的PHP配置满足Magento的要求,如适当的内存限制、上传文件大小限制等。

硬件要求

除了软件配置外,服务器的硬件也是至关重要的。以下是一些关于硬件要求的建议:

  • 处理器:建议使用至少双核处理器,以确保足够的计算能力。
  • 内存:最低建议使用2GB的内存,但建议使用4GB或更高来处理大量数据和并发请求。
  • 存储空间:根据商店的规模和产品数量来选择适当的存储空间。建议使用固态硬盘(SSD)以提供更好的读写性能。

当然,这只是一些基本的建议,您可以根据自己的具体情况进行调整。

安全性

在配置服务器时,确保考虑到网站的安全性。使用安全的传输协议(如HTTPS)来保护用户的隐私和数据安全。此外,定期备份网站数据是非常重要的,以应对意外情况和数据丢失的风险。

总结

通过正确配置和优化服务器,确保满足Magento的服务器要求,您将能够提供稳定、高性能的在线商店,并为用户提供良好的购物体验。

无论是选择合适的操作系统、Web服务器,还是优化数据库和PHP配置,都需要根据自己的需求和情况做出适当的选择。同时,确保服务器的安全性和数据备份也是不可忽视的。

希望以上关于Magento服务器要求的指南能够对您有所帮助,带来顺利的Magento搭建和运行经验!

三、magento 服务器迁移

尊敬的读者,今天我想与您分享一些关于Magento服务器迁移的内容。作为一名博主,我熟悉编写各类技术文章,并准备为您提供关于此话题的详细信息。

Magento 服务器迁移的重要性

随着电子商务的迅猛发展,以及Magento作为其中最具影响力的平台之一,对于拥有Magento网站的企业来说,一个可靠且高性能的服务器是至关重要的。但是,在某些情况下,您可能需要对已部署的Magento网站进行服务器迁移。服务器迁移可能是由于业务扩大、性能问题、安全性要求、技术升级或者更换服务供应商。

无论迁移的原因是什么,都需要谨慎处理以确保成功完成迁移过程,而不会对网站的可用性和性能造成负面影响。下面是一些关于如何进行Magento服务器迁移的重要考虑因素:

1. 准备工作

在进行Magento服务器迁移之前,您需要进行详细的准备工作,包括备份所有关键数据、文件和配置。此外,您还应该确保新服务器满足Magento的系统要求,并准备好在新服务器上安装和配置相关软件和服务。

为了确保数据的安全性,请务必在迁移之前创建数据库备份,并测试备份文件以确保其有效性。这将有助于在迁移过程中出现任何问题时迅速恢复数据。

2. 迁移Magento文件和数据库

一旦完成准备工作,接下来的步骤是迁移Magento文件和数据库。您可以通过FTP或者备份文件直接复制网站文件到新服务器上,确保文件的完整性和准确性。

对于数据库迁移,您可以通过导出当前Magento网站的数据库,并在新服务器上创建一个新的数据库。然后,将导出的数据库文件导入到新服务器上的新数据库中。

当迁移文件和数据库时,您需要确保路径和配置文件的准确性。您可能需要更新数据库连接和其他配置信息以适应新的服务器设置。

3. 测试和调试

在完成Magento服务器迁移之后,务必对网站进行全面的测试和调试以确保一切正常运行。您应该测试网站的各个功能模块,包括商品展示、购物车、订单处理和支付流程等。

同时,还应该测试网站的性能和加载速度。确保新服务器能够提供与以前服务器相当或更好的性能指标。如果发现任何问题或性能下降,您可能需要进一步优化和调整服务器设置。

4. DNS切换和域名解析

当您完成对Magento网站的迁移,并确保一切正常之后,最后一步是进行DNS切换和域名解析。您需要将域名解析指向新服务器的IP地址,以确保访问者可以正确访问您的网站。

在进行DNS切换之前,建议您将TTL(Time-To-Live)设置为较低的值,以便更快地传播DNS更改并减少访问者的中断时间。在切换后,您可以将TTL设置为更高的值以提高缓存效果。

结论

Magento服务器迁移是一个复杂的过程,需要谨慎规划和执行。为了确保成功迁移,您应该进行详细的准备工作,迁移Magento文件和数据库,测试和调试网站并进行DNS切换。

通过遵循上述步骤和考虑因素,您可以成功地将Magento网站迁移到新的服务器上,确保网站的可用性和性能。祝您的迁移顺利!

四、magento 上传服务器

如今,在互联网时代,开设电子商务平台已经成为很多企业的必备选择。然而,搭建一个成功的电子商务网站并不是一件容易的事情。无论是初次涉足电子商务领域的新手,还是已经运营电子商务网站多年的老手,都面临着诸多挑战。其中之一就是将Magento网站上传到服务器上。

为什么选择Magento?

Magento是最受欢迎和功能强大的电子商务平台之一。它提供了丰富的功能和灵活的定制选项,使您能够创建和管理各种类型的在线商店。Magento不仅具有强大的产品目录管理和订单管理功能,而且还支持多种支付网关和配送方式,使您的商店能够满足各种需求。此外,Magento还提供了大量的扩展和主题,使您可以根据自己的品牌形象和目标受众来定制您的网站。

上传Magento到服务器的步骤

下面是将Magento上传到服务器上的步骤:

  1. 准备服务器环境:在上传Magento之前,您需要确保服务器环境满足Magento的要求。这包括PHP版本、数据库支持等。您可以通过Magento官方网站获得详细的系统要求。
  2. 下载和解压Magento:从Magento官方网站下载最新版的Magento。然后,将下载的文件解压到您希望安装Magento的文件夹中。
  3. 创建数据库:在上传Magento之前,您需要创建一个数据库来存储Magento的数据。您可以使用phpMyAdmin或MySQL命令行工具来创建数据库。
  4. 设置文件权限:为了确保Magento能够正常运行,您需要设置正确的文件和文件夹权限。这包括设置文件夹权限为755,设置文件权限为644等。
  5. 运行安装向导:通过访问您的Magento网站的域名或IP地址,运行安装向导。在安装向导中,您需要输入数据库连接信息、管理员账户信息等。
  6. 完成安装:按照安装向导的提示,完成Magento的安装过程。安装完成后,您可以登录到Magento的后台管理界面,开始配置您的电子商务网站。

一些建议

在上传Magento到服务器之前,有一些值得注意的事项:

  • 备份文件和数据库:在进行任何修改之前,我们强烈建议您备份您的文件和数据库。这样,如果出现意外情况,您可以轻松地恢复到之前的状态。
  • 选择可靠的主机提供商:选择一个可靠的主机提供商非常重要。他们应该提供稳定的服务器环境和快速的技术支持。这样,您就可以专注于经营您的电子商务网站,而不必担心服务器问题。
  • 定期更新Magento:Magento团队经常发布更新和安全补丁,以改进功能并修复漏洞。定期更新您的Magento网站可以帮助您保持安全并享受最新的功能。
  • 使用CDN加速:使用内容分发网络(CDN)可以加速您的网站加载速度,并提供更好的用户体验。考虑使用CDN来提高您的Magento网站的性能。

结论

将Magento网站上传到服务器可能是一个有挑战的过程,但随着正确的步骤和准备,您将能够成功完成。选择Magento作为您的电子商务平台,将为您提供丰富的功能和灵活的定制选项。记住遵循最佳实践,并始终保持您的网站安全和最新。

五、Magento是什么?

? Magento是一个正在全球范围内迅速发展的开源电子商务网站开发平台。

Magento系统设计灵活、操作方便,其面向企业级应用,可处理各方面的需求。

六、magento 上传服务器404

如何解决Magento上传服务器404错误

对于经营在线商店的Magento用户来说,文件上传是一个经常需要进行的操作,无论是上传产品图片,还是上传主题或扩展文件。然而,有时候在上传文件时可能会遇到404错误的问题,这会给用户带来很大的困扰。本文将为大家介绍如何解决Magento上传服务器404错误。

什么是Magento上传服务器404错误

首先,我们需要了解Magento上传服务器404错误的含义。当您在Magento后台上传文件时,如果遇到这个错误,意味着服务器无法找到要上传的文件或目录。这可能是由于文件路径错误、权限设置问题或服务器配置不正确导致的。

解决Magento上传服务器404错误的方法

以下是一些可能的解决方法,您可以根据具体情况尝试:

  1. 检查文件路径

    首先,您需要确保您要上传的文件路径是正确的。在Magento后台进行上传操作时,请仔细检查您输入的文件路径是否包含正确的文件夹名称和文件名。如果路径错误,系统将无法找到文件,从而导致404错误。

  2. 检查文件和文件夹权限

    如果文件路径正确,但仍然遇到404错误,则可能是由于文件或文件夹权限设置不正确。请确保您要上传的文件具有正确的读写权限。您可以通过FTP或文件管理器工具访问服务器,并将文件和文件夹权限设置为适当的数值(例如755或777)。

  3. 检查.htaccess文件

    有时候,Magento部分页面的404错误可能是由于.htaccess文件中的规则冲突或错误导致的。请确保您的Magento安装目录下的.htaccess文件没有被修改或更改过。如果有任何不确定的地方,请备份该文件,并恢复到默认设置。

  4. 检查服务器配置

    Magento上传服务器404错误可能是由于服务器配置不正确导致的。您可以联系您的服务器主机提供商,咨询是否需要进行服务器配置更改以支持文件上传功能。他们可能会为您做一些必要的调整,以确保文件上传功能正常工作。

  5. 检查Magento设置

    最后,如果以上方法均无法解决问题,您可以检查Magento的设置。请确保您的Magento版本是最新的,并且您已经进行了所有必要的配置。您可以访问Magento的官方文档,查找有关文件上传的详细信息,并按照指引进行操作。

总结

Magento上传服务器404错误可能会给用户的在线商店带来很多麻烦和不便。然而,通过仔细检查文件路径、文件和文件夹权限、.htaccess文件、服务器配置以及Magento设置,您应该能够解决这个问题。

如果您仍然无法解决上传服务器404错误,请考虑寻求专业技术人员的帮助。他们将能够更深入地分析并解决这个问题。

希望本文对您解决Magento上传服务器404错误问题有所帮助!

七、magento系统和magento2.0系统升级后的区别?

Magento是一套专业开源的电子商务系统,也是目前主流的外贸网站购物系统,都是居于PHP语言开发的,数据库使用的是Mysql,且浏览界面很适合欧美用户的使用习惯。Magento设计得非常灵活,具有模块化架构体系和丰富的功能。 magento2.0的优势在于:

1、开放、灵活的体系结构

2、吸引人的购物体验

3、增强业务得灵活性和效率

4、企业级可扩展性和性能

5、安全支付

6、易于维护和升级 美赞拓 拥有magento开源系统,现在已升级magento2.0外贸建站系统

八、magento centos

Magento 是一款备受推崇的开源电子商务平台,可为在线零售商提供强大的功能和灵活的体验。作为一款流行的电子商务解决方案,Magento 在网上商店建设和管理方面具有显著优势,在商业领域得到了广泛应用。而 CentOS ,作为一种基于Linux 的开源操作系统,提供了稳定性和安全性,深受企业用户的喜爱。

Magento 网店的优势

使用 Magento 搭建网店的优势之一是其功能强大而灵活的特性。Magento 提供了多种定制选项,可以根据用户需求进行个性化设置,包括主题、扩展和插件等。这种灵活性使得用户能够轻松创建符合自身品牌形象和业务需求的网店。

CentOS 作为 Magento 的最佳托管选择

选择合适的托管服务对于 Magento 网店的性能至关重要。而 CentOS 正是一种可靠的操作系统选择,可为 Magento 提供安全、高效的运行环境。由于其稳定性和开源特性,CentOS 能够满足 Magento 对于安全性、稳定性和性能的需求。

如何在 CentOS 上部署 Magento

在 CentOS 上部署 Magento 可以通过多种方式实现,但通常推荐使用 LAMP 或 LNMP 环境来构建 Magento 网店。以下是在 CentOS 上部署 Magento 的主要步骤:

  • 安装 LAMP / LNMP 环境: 在 CentOS 上安装 Apache/Nginx、MySQL 和 PHP,创建适合 Magento 运行的环境。
  • 下载 Magento: 从 Magento 官方网站下载最新版本的 Magento 并解压缩至网站根目录。
  • 配置数据库: 创建新的 MySQL 数据库和用户,并将其关联到 Magento 网店。
  • 配置 Magento: 通过访问 Magento 安装向导来完成网店的基本设置和配置。
  • 优化性能: 针对 Magento 的性能进行调整和优化,包括缓存设置、图片压缩等。

Magento 网店的 SEO 优化

在搭建完 Magento 网店后,进行 SEO 优化将有助于提升网店的可见性和流量。以下是一些 Magento 网店 SEO 优化的关键步骤:

  • 关键字优化: 确保在网站内容中包含相关关键字,并合理布局在标题、描述和内容中。
  • 友好 URL: 使用有意义的 URL 结构,包括关键字,以便搜索引擎更好地理解页面内容。
  • 图片优化: 优化图片文件名和 alt 文本,帮助搜索引擎理解图片内容。
  • 网站速度: 确保网站加载速度快,优化图片大小、使用合适的缓存策略等。
  • 响应式设计: 确保网站具有响应式设计,适应不同设备的显示效果,提升用户体验。

总结

结合 Magento 强大的电子商务功能和 CentOS 可靠的操作系统环境,可以构建一个性能卓越、安全可靠的网店。通过在 CentOS 上部署 Magento,并进行 SEO 优化,不仅可以提升网店的用户体验,还能为网店带来更多的流量和销售机会。

九、如何清除magento数据?

第一次用最好安装演示数据,以熟悉网站架构。然后后台手动删除,或者把数据删除,重装magento。

十、magento如何运行框架?

简单与难都是相对的,只要肯做再难的也应该可以搞定。

Magento的框架是基于zend改写的,可以先看zend。或者直接找一个相对简单的插件,从配置文件 到模型方法,再到前台调用 一步一步吃透它,慢慢就简单了。网上也有很多Magento二次开发的教程,可以搜来看看. :-)